Precision travel positioning for translating screw jacks
A Cleveland-based manufacturer of linear motion-control systems and components offers a system to provide precision position control for translating screw jack systems.
Nook Industries says its Nook Sensor System has a highly accurate repeatability of up to + .004″ (0.1MM), and is designed for their ActionJac translating screw jacks. The system also features a cylindrical aluminum stem cover that serves as a houses shroud for select position and travel limit sensors mounted with custom profiles and used to detect ring magnets fixed to the translating screw. The basis of sensor operation is an electronic magnetic circuit.
The sensors on the system are manufactured using a polypropylene over-molding that the company says allows the sensor to be completely sealed into small sizes without compromising durability. An unlimited number of sensors can be added to meet a wide-range of position sensing requirements as configurations with the company’s translating screw jacks are only restricted by the stem cover length.
The cost efficient system replaces higher cost rotary limit switches with a simple aluminum-stem housing that adds the functionality of position sensing versus traditional steel stem covers. The design can be incorporated in many industrial applications including material handling, defense, areospace, medical devices, stamping, conveying, and sorting.
